Description: MENA (mammalian enabled protein) is involved in the regulation of cytoskeletal dynamics, and accumulates at focal adhesions. MENA is highly expressed in the developing nervous system and may be involved in growth cone motility and axon guidance. Note: Conjugates of blue fluorescent dyes like CF®405S and CF®405M are not recommended for detecting low abundance targets, because blue dyes have lower fluorescence and can give higher non-specific background than other dye colors.
